Synthetic leather is also known as faux leather, imitation leather, vegan leather and artificial leather. It is widely used in recent times, owing to its various advantages over genuine leather, such as sustainable nature, customization and affordability.
Synthetic leather is manufactured using various raw materials including polyurethane (PU), polyvinyl chloride (PVC) and different bio-based agricultural wastes, including banana stems, cactus, mango peels and pineapple wastes. Further, with continuous evolution and advancement in technology, synthetic leathers are crafted from cactus leaves, banana stem, corn husk and pineapples waste. Notably, the synthetic leather industry is moving towards sustainability through adoption of bio-based synthetic leather derived from natural sources. Synthetic leather provides various features, such as stain, abrasion resistant, waterproof, washable, breathable, heat-resistant and lightweight. It is worth highlighting that synthetic leather is used across different industries, including automotive industry, bags and wallets, clothing, electronics, footwear, furnishing and upholstery. ,

The current market landscape features the presence of more than 235 companies that are engaged in the manufacturing of synthetic leather. Overall, the market seems to be well-distributed, comprising of very large, large, mid-sized and small artificial leather manufacturers. It is also worth highlighting that close to 80% of the synthetic leather companies are based in Asia, followed by North America (9%) and Europe (8%).
Stakeholders in the synthetic leather industry have forged several partnerships with organizations to drive technological advancements and expand application area in synthetic leather domain. For instance, in February 2024, BASF Monomers Division and Xuchuan Chemical forged an alliance in order to facilitate the use of bio-mass balanced (BMB) Methylene Diphenyl Di-isocyanate (MDI) in synthetic leather applications. The partnership aims to reduce carbon emissions in polyurethane production for the synthetic leather industry. Further, In August 2023, DK&D entered into a strategic partnership with Ningbo Hengqide Chemical Fiber Technology to jointly produce synthetic leather for San Fang Chemical Industry customers.
